First of all, we need to know the development process of warm bubbles. The follicle grows at a rate of 0.2CM per day. When the follicle develops to 1.8CM-2.5CM, it is considered mature. The mature follicle may be discharged at any time. You can calculate the approximate ovulation time based on this rate combined with your current follicle size. The characteristics of mature follicles, B-ultrasound monitoring shows that the largest follicle appears on the 10th to 16th day of menstruation. The follicle is 20mm in diameter, round in shape, with thin walls, protruding to one side of the ovary, and good internal sound transmission. Generally, ovulation occurs within 10 hours. Ovulation is more common within the 12th to 18th day of menstruation, and a few can occur at 20-30 days. Characteristics after ovulation: partial collapse of the follicle wall, the edges are wrinkled and jagged, with many faint light spots inside, and a 5-15mm liquid dark area can be seen in the uterine rectal crypts, which usually disappears one day after ovulation.
